(1):

(v. t.) To repeat, as the principal points in a discourse, argument, or essay; to give a summary of the principal facts, points, or arguments of; to relate in brief; to summarize.

(2):

(v. i.) To sum up, or enumerate by heads or topics, what has been previously said; to repeat briefly the substance.
